明文缔造的历史与发展明文缔造是一种在计算机安全领域中广泛应用的密码学技术。它是由美国国家安全局(NSA)在20世纪70年代初期开发的一种对称密码算法。该算法旨在为军事和政府机构提供一种高度安全的通信方式,以保护敏感信息免受未经授权的访问和窃听。1.1 算法的诞生明文缔造算法的起源可以追溯到1974年。当时,美国国家标准与技术研究所(NIST,前身为国家标准局)开始寻找一种可替代当时已经过时的数据加密标准(DES)的新的加密算法。NSA随后提出了一种新的算法,命名为"混淆数据变换"(Lucifer)。该算法于1977年正式公布,并且在1978年被美国政府采用,成为联邦信息处理标准(FIPS)第46号,即数据加密标准(DES)。DES算法在当时被认为是足够安全的,但由于其密钥长度仅为56位,在计算机性能不断提升的大环境下,已经不足以抵御暴力破解攻击。于是,NIST在1997年开始寻找一种更加安全的替代算法。经过几年的公开征集和评选,明文缔造算法最终在2001年被选定为新的联邦信息处理标准第197号(FIPS 197),即高级加密标准(AES)。1.2 算法的特点明文缔造算法作为一种对称密码算法,其工作原理主要包括以下几个步骤:1) 密钥扩展:根据输入的密钥,生成若干个子密钥,用于后续的加密和解密过程。 2) 轮函数:将明文和子密钥进行多次复杂的数学运算,以达到加密的目的。 3) 加密过程:将明文经过多轮的轮函数处理,最终得到密文。 4) 解密过程:将密文经过与加密过程相反的多轮轮函数处理,还原出原始的明文。与DES算法相比,明文缔造算法具有以下几个显著优点:1) 更长的密钥长度:明文缔造算法支持128位、192位和256位三种密钥长度,可以有效抵御暴力破解攻击。 2) 更高的安全性:明文缔造算法采用了先进的数学运算和复杂的轮函数设计,大大提高了算法的抗密码分析能力。 3) 更高的效率:该算法的设计充分考虑了现代计算机硬件的性能特点,在软件和硬件实现上都表现出较高的计算效率。 4) 广泛的应用:明文缔造算法已经成为当今密码学领域事实上的标准,广泛应用于各种网络协议、安全产品和加密系统之中。1.3 算法的发展自从明文缔造算法被NIST正式采纳为新的联邦信息处理标准后,该算法就一直保持着持续的发展和完善。2006年,NIST发布了明文缔造算法的第二版本(AES-2),在加密强度和
同时。司机兴奋地说,兄弟啊,不知道你看没看新闻,真是大快人心啊。。"从2015年4月16日起,阿提哈德航空将增加飞往达拉斯/沃斯堡的新航班频率,达拉斯/沃斯堡航班将于12月3日开始,最初每周有3个航班。"开普敦最著名的两家餐厅Zingara夫人和Cara Lazuli在今天凌晨被烧毁。青青翠翠,欣赏。